    (i) Atomic number: The atomic number is the total number of protons present in the atom. For example, the atomic number of sodium is 11. It contains 11 protons and 11 electrons.
    (ii) Mass number: It is the sum of the number of neutrons and the number of protons. For example, the atomic number of magnesium is 12 which is equal to the number of protons, the number of neutrons of magnesium is 12. The mass number is equal to 24 (12+12).
    (iii) Isotopes are the elements having same atomic number but different mass number. They have same chemical properties as the number of valence electrons are same. For example, 6​C12, 6​C13, 6​C14 are the three isotopes of carbon. They have same atomic number but different mass number due to difference in the number of neutrons.
    (iv) Isobars: They are elements having the same mass number but different atomic number. For example. 18​Ar40, 19​K40 are isobars having the same atomic mass but different atomic number.
    The two uses of isotopes are:
    Nuclear weapons and nuclear power require large quantities of isotopes of uranium.An isotope of cobalt is used in the treatment of cancer.

    [10/12, 6:52 PM] Anshuman: Q1. Look at the activities listed below. Reason out whether or not work is done in the light of your understanding of the term ‘work’.
    (a) Suma is swimming in a pond.
    (b) A donkey is carrying a load on its back.
    (c) A wind mill is lifting water from a well.
    (d) A green plant is carrying out photosynthesis.
    (e) An engine is pulling a train.
    (f) Food grains are getting dried in the sun.
    (g) A sailboat is moving due to wind energy.
    Work is done whenever the given conditions are satisfied:
    (i) A force acts on a body.
    (ii) There is a displacement of the body.
    (a) While swimming, Suma applies a force to push the water backwards. Therefore, Suma swims in the forward direction caused by the forward reaction of water. Here, the force causes a displacement. Hence, work is done by Seema while swimming.
    (b) While carrying a load, the donkey has to apply a force in the upward direction. But, displacement of the load is in the forward direction. Since, displacement is perpendicular to force, the work done is zero.
    (c) A wind mill works against the gravitational force to lift water. Hence, work is done by the wind mill in lifting water from the well.
    (d) In this case, there is no displacement of the leaves of the plant. Therefore, the work done is zero.
    (e) An engine applies force to pull the train. This allows the train to move in the direction of force. Therefore, there is a displacement in the train in the same direction. Hence, work is done by the engine on the train.
    (f) Food grains do not move in the presence of solar energy. Hence, the work done is zero during the process of food grains getting dried in the Sun.
    (g) Wind energy applies a force on the sailboat to push it in the forward direction. Therefore, there is a displacement in the boat in the direction of force. Hence, work is done by wind on the boat.
    Q2. An object thrown at a certain angle to the ground moves in a curved path and falls back to the ground. The initial and the final points of the path of the object lie on the same horizontal line. What is the work done by the force of gravity on the object?
    Since the body returns to a point which is on the same horizontal line through the point of projection, no displacement has taken place against the force of gravity, therefore, no work is done by the force due to gravity.
    Q3. A battery lights a bulb. Describe the energy changes involved in the process.
    Within the electric cell of the battery the chemical energy changes into electrical energy. The electric
    energy on flowing through the filament of the bulb, first changes into heat energy and then into the light energy.
    [10/12, 6:53 PM] Anshuman: Q5. A mass of 10 kg is at a point A on a table. It is moved to a point B. If the line joining A and B is horizontal, what is the work done on the object by the gravitational force? Explain your answer.
    The work done is zero. This is because the gravitational force and displacement are perpendicular to each other.
    Q6. The potential energy of a freely falling object decreases progressively. Does this violate the law of conservation of energy? Why?
    It does not violate the law Of conservation of energy. Whatever, is the decrease in PE due to loss of height, same is the increase in the KE due to increase in velocity of the body.
    Q7. What are the various energy transformations that occur when you are riding a bicycle?
    The chemical energy of the food changes into heat and then to muscular energy. On paddling, the muscular energy changes into mechanical energy
    Q8. Does the transfer of energy take place when you push a huge rock with all your might and fail to move it? Where is the energy you spend going?
    Energy transfer does not take place as no displacement takes place in the direction of applied force. The energy spent is used to overcome inertia of rest of the rock.

    [12/11, 7:55 PM] Anshuman: Which party had been ruling Haryana since 1982?
    Ans. The Congress party had been ruling Haryana since 1982. 2. Who was Chaudhary Devilal? Name the party formed by him. Ans. Chaudhary Devilal was an opposition leader. He formed a new party called the Lok Dal,
    3. Which promises of Devilal draw in election campaign attracted the people? Ans. He promised to waive the loans of small farmers and small businessmen.
    4. What was the result of the elections in Haryana in 1987?
    Ans. Lok Dal and its partners won 76 out of 90 seats, with Lok Dal alone winning 60 seats. The Cong could win only 5 seats.
    5. Why did the Chief Minister resign?
    Ans. His party lost the elections. Only the leader of the majority party can form a government.
    6. Why do we have representatives in most democracies?
    Ans. In most democracies people rule through their representatives because it is not possible for ever to have time and knowledge to take decisions on all matters.

    [09/11, 6:34 PM] ABHIJIT: Protons, electrons and neutrons have different properties like different charge, mass and stability. Protons are positively charged particles. Electrons are negatively charged particles. Neutrons are neutral particles which mean that they have no charge.
    [09/11, 6:35 PM] ABHIJIT: Thomson's atomic model failed to explain how the positive charge holds on the electrons inside the atom. It also failed to explain an atom's stability. The theory did not mention anything about the nucleus of an atom.
    [09/11, 6:36 PM] ABHIJIT: The major limitations of Rutherford’s model of the atom are:
    It does not explain the stability of the atom. As we know now, when charged bodies move in a circular motion, they emit radiations. This means that the electrons revolving around the nucleus (as suggested by Rutherford) would lose energy and come closer and closer to the nucleus, and a stage will come when they would finally merge into the nucleus. This makes the atom unstable, which is clearly not the case. The electrons do not fall into the nucleus, atoms are very stable and do not collapse on their own.
    [09/11, 6:37 PM] ABHIJIT: According to Bohr Atomic model, a small positively charged nucleus is surrounded by revolving negatively charged electrons in fixed orbits. He concluded that electron will have more energy if it is located away from the nucleus whereas the electrons will have less energy if it located near the nucleus.

    [14/11, 8:12 PM] ABHIJIT: [14/11, 7:43 PM] Anshuman: Define the term 'work'. State the SI unit of work.
    Work is said to be done when a force displaces an object through a certain distance in the direction of the force. The SI unit of work is newton metre (Nm) also known as joule (J) in honour of the physicist James Joule.
    Define 1 joule.
    1 J is the amount of work done on an object when a force of 1 N displaces the object through 1m in the direction of the force. 1 joule = 1 newton x 1 metre.
    A boy tries to push a truck parked on the roadside. The truck does not move at all. Another boy pushes a bicycle. The bicycle moves through a certain distance. In which case was the work done more : on the truck or on the bicycle? Give a reason to support your answer.
    The work done was more on the bicycle. Work done depends on force and displacement. Since the bicycle gets displaced and the truck does not, more work is done on the bicycle than the truck.
    How much work is done when a body of mass m is raised to a height h above
    the ground? Work done when a body of mass m is raised to a height h above the ground is given by "mgh".
    Is it possible that a force is acting on a body but sill the work done is zero? Explain giving one example.
    A force does not work if
    (a) The displacement is perpendicular to the force applied and (b) Applied force does not produce any displacement.
    Eg. (i) Earth is moving round the sun is almost circular orbit. In this case, the gravitational force is along the radius of the orbit while the instantaneous motion is tangential. As force and displacement are perpendicular to each other, the net work done is zero.
    (ii) A boy pushes the wall but the wall does not move. Hence, work done is zero.
    Complete the following sentence:
    The work done on a body moving in a circular path is
    The work done on a body moving in a circular path is zero.

    Define the term 'energy' of a body. What is the SI unit of energy? Is energy a vector quantity? What are the various forms of energy?
    The capability of an object to do work is known as energy. The SI unit of energy is joule (J). No, it is not a vector quantity. Energy exists in many different forms. The various forms of energy include mechanical energy, heat energy, chemical energy, electrical energy, light energy, sound energy, etc.
    What do you understand by the kinetic energy of a body?
    Energy possessed by an object by virtue of its motion is called kinetic energy (E).
    By how much will the kinetic energy of a body increase if its speed is doubled? If the speed of an object is doubled, its kinetic energy increases by 4 times.
    What is meant by potential energy? Write down the expression for gravitational potential energy of a body of mass m placed at a height h above the surface of the earth.
    The energy possessed by an object by virtue of its position or configuration is called as potential energy. The gravitational potential energy of a body of mass m at a height h above the surface of the earth is given by mgh.
    [14/11, 7:46 PM] Anshuman: State and explain the law of conservation of energy with an example.
    (i) Law of conservation of energy states that, "Energy can neither be created nor be destroyed. It can only be transformed from one form to the other. The total amount of energy in the universe always remains constant.
    (ii) Consider a simple example. Let an object of mass 'm' be made to fall freely
    from a height 'h'.
    (iii) At the start, the potential energy is mgh while the kinetic energy is zero. It is zero because the velocity is zero.
    (iv) The total energy of the object is thus mgh (mgh + 0) . As it falls, its potential energy changes into kinetic energy. If v ^ prime is the velocity at any instant, the kinetic energy would be 1/2 * m * v ^ 2
    (v) As the fall of the object continues, the potential energy decreases while kinetic energy increases.
    (vi) When the object is about to touch the ground, h = 0 and v will be highest. Thus, potential energy is the least (zero) while kinetic energy is maximum. (vii) However at all points, the sum of kinetic and potential energies would be the

    [22/11, 8:01 PM] Anshuman: 12. If bromine atom is available in the form of, say, two isotopes 35Br79 (49.7%) and 35Br81 (50.3%), calculate the average atomic mass of Bromine atom.
    Solution:
    The atomic mass of an element is the mass of one atom of that element. Average atomic mass takes into account the isotopic abundance.
    Isotope of bromine with atomic mass 79 u = 49.7%
    Therefore, Contribution of 35Br79 to atomic mass = (79 × 49.7)/100
    ⇒ 39.26 u
    Isotope of bromine with atomic mass 81 u = 50.3%
    Contribution of 35Br81 to the atomic mass of bromine = (81 × 50.3)/100
    ⇒ 40.64u
    Hence, average atomic mass of the bromine atom = 39.26 + 40.64 u = 79.9u
    13. The average atomic mass of a sample of an element X is 16.2 u. What are the percentages of isotopes 8X16 and 8X18 in the sample?
    Solution:
    Let the percentage of 8X16 be ‘a’ and that of 8X18 be ‘100-a’.
    As per given data,
    16.2u = 16 a / 100 + 18 (100-a) /100
    1620 = 16a + 1800 - 18a
    1620 = 1800 - 2a
    a = 90%
    Hence, the percentage of isotope in the sample 8X16 is 90% and that of
    8X18 = 100-a = 100- 90=10%
    14. If Z=3, what would be the valency of the element? Also, name the element.
    Solution:
    Given: Atomic number, Z = 3
    The electronic configuration of the element = K-2; L-1, hence its valency = 1
    The element with atomic number 3 is Lithium.
